Dont have secondary axis option listed in Series Option
I am trying to creat a seconday axis. In Excel 2007 from the Series Options
tab on the Format Data Series prompt, I only have the following options: Gap depth and Gap width instead of primary and secondary axis. What am I doing wrong or how do I get these options |

Dont have secondary axis option listed in Series Option
You need to plot a second series in the chart in order to obtain
secondary axes. Also, 3D charts do not accommodate secondary axes. Yet another reason not to use 3D charts. - Jon ------- Jon Peltier Peltier Technical Services, Inc. 774-275-0064 http://peltiertech.com/ On 2/23/2010 12:02 PM, Venus wrote: I am trying to creat a seconday axis.
